Understanding the Internet of Things:

At its core, the Internet of Things refers to the network of interconnected devices that communicate and share data with each other. These devices can range from everyday household items like refrigerators and thermostats to complex industrial machinery. The magic lies in their ability to gather and exchange information, fostering a web of connectivity that transforms the way we live and work.

The Building Blocks of IoT Connectivity:

Sensors and Actuators:

Sensors serve as the eyes and ears of IoT devices, collecting data from the environment. Actuators, on the other hand, are the limbs, executing commands based on the information received. Together, they form the foundation of IoT connectivity.

Communication Protocols:

IoT devices communicate through various protocols such as MQTT, CoAP, and HTTP. Understanding these protocols is crucial for ensuring seamless data exchange between devices and the central system.

Cloud Computing:

The cloud plays a pivotal role in the IoT ecosystem. It serves as a central hub where data is processed, stored, and analyzed. Cloud computing enables scalability, accessibility, and real-time insights, empowering IoT devices to perform at their best.

Connecting Your Devices:

Choose Compatible Devices:

When venturing into the world of IoT, it's essential to select devices that are compatible with each other. Ensure that they use the same communication protocols and standards to guarantee smooth interaction.

Network Security:

Security is paramount in the IoT landscape. Implement robust security measures such as encryption and authentication to safeguard your devices and data from potential threats.

IoT Platforms:

Explore IoT platforms that act as intermediaries between your devices and the cloud. These platforms simplify the management of connected devices, offering features like data analytics, remote monitoring, and firmware updates.

Taking Control of Your IoT Ecosystem:

Mobile Apps and Dashboards:

Many IoT devices come with dedicated mobile apps or web-based dashboards that allow you to monitor and control them remotely. Familiarize yourself with these interfaces to make the most of your IoT experience.

Automation and Machine Learning:

Harness the power of automation and machine learning to create intelligent and adaptive systems. Set up scenarios where your devices respond to specific triggers or learn from user behavior to enhance their performance over time.
